Anita Fleerackers shows artistic racing bike at art fair at Louvre: “Bike is full of toros or bulls”

LILLE – Artist Anita Fleerackers from Gierle (Lille) participated last weekend in the art event ArtShopping Louvre in Paris. There she showed a pimped out racing bike of Ludo Boeckx of cycling club Het Vliegend Wiel from Lille.

Dozens of artists from all over Europe participated in ArtShopping Louvre this past weekend at the Carrousel du Louvre shopping center near the world-renowned museum.
Anita Fleerackers and her husband Staf Campforts from Gierle also had a booth at the art fair with a selection of works of art. The big eye-catcher was a racing bike of Ludo Boeckx, president of cycling club Het Vliegend Wiel from Lille. He had his racing bike taken care of by Anita Fleerackers.
“Ludo’s bike was artistically cuddled by my toros or bulls,” explains Anita Fleerackers. “My husband Staf and I were responsible for the design and a Dutch company took care of the bike. Ludo came to me asking to wrap his bike. After making several designs together with my husband and a few more color adjustments, we arrived at this beautiful result. The level of finish was of the professional highest quality.”
The artful bicycle was not for sale in Paris, but it attracted considerable interest.
